Arizona Copper Mining: History, Economy, And Sustainability

Cowboy copper is a term used to refer to the copper mining industry in Arizona, particularly in the area known as the Copper Corridor. Copper has played a significant role in the state’s history and economy, with numerous mining operations and stakeholders involved, including federal agencies regulating mining practices, major mining companies driving economic development, conservation organizations advocating for environmental protection, tribal nations with cultural ties to the land, historical institutions preserving mining heritage, educational institutions conducting research and education, industry associations representing companies’ interests, and diverse perspectives on sustainable and responsible mining practices in the region.
